Robust μ-distortion constraints on primordial supermassive black holes from cubic (gNL) non-Gaussian perturbations

Authors

Xavier Pritchard, Christian T. Byrnes, Julien Lesgourgues, Devanshu Sharma

Abstract

We make the first calculation of the spectral distortion constraints on the primordial curvature power spectrum in the limit of large cubic non-Gaussianity. This calculation involves computing a 2-loop integral, which we perform analytically. Despite being non-perturbatively non-Gaussian, we show that the constraints only change significantly from the case of Gaussian perturbations in the high-k tail, where spectral distortions become weak. We conclude that generating primordial supermassive black holes requires even more extreme forms of non-Gaussianity. We also argue why the mu-distortion constraint is unlikely to significantly change even in the presence of more extreme local non-Gaussianity.
